Add Insulation When the Weather is Cooler
To make your home more energy efficient, update your insulation in the spring, if possible — before it gets dangerously hot in your attic. Rent equipment made for insulation to get it installed correctly. Choose from a cellulose insulation blower or a fiberglass blower, and insulate those nooks and crannies with ease. Installing insulation keeps your home c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ter, all while tempering your heating and cooling bills.

Frequently Asked Questions about Rentals

How do I rent tools or trucks?

Stop by the Rental Center at your nearest Home Depot to see what's available. If you'd like to be sure of what's in stock, call first to inquire about a truck or tool. You might also visit our tool and equipment rental or truck rental pages to see if what you need is at your store. For more details on renting tools, read the Tool Rental FAQs, including terms and conditions for the equipment.

Can I rent a tool for a day?

You can rent a tool for four hours or more. It depends on how long you'd like to rent them. Small home improvement jobs may only require a short rental period, and bigger jobs aren't a problem either. You've got options to rent tools by the day, month, or week, too. If you need it longer than your initial rental period, call your Rental Center for an extension and avoid late fees.

When do I return the tools?

You're welcome to return the tools early if you finish your project ahead of schedule, but on-time works, too. Just make sure to bring them back by the deadline listed on your rental paperwork. Please clean off residual dust, mud, and grime from the tool as well. If you need it longer, call your local rental center to see if you can extend your rental period.

How long can I rent a truck?

Rent a box truck, cargo van, or flatbed truck for as long as you need it. For short trips, 75 minutes might be enough time. Otherwise, consider renting it by the week or the day, depending on how long your project is. Don't forget to factor in the drive between the job site and the store, as you'll need to bring it back to the same store where you rented it. Penske moving truck rentals allow round-trip options as well as one-way options, and they have different terms. Make sure to read the provided documentation before choosing your truck.

Do I need to refuel the rental truck when I'm done?

Yes, please fill up the truck before you bring it back. Match the amount of gas that was in the tank when you got the rental. If you don't, you'll be hit with a penalty known as the fuel replacement charge.

Do I just need a driver's license to rent a truck?

No, you must hold a valid driver's license and be over the age of 21. Depending on your state, you might require car insurance, as well as a credit card hold or a deposit, too. Please bring your credit card for Home Depot truck rentals, as we don't accept cash. Penske moving truck rentals have different requirements.
